Is snoozing an email to infinity the same as archiving it?


Conceptually anyway.


  👤 Minor49er Accepted Answer ✓
I've used several email applications including Gmail, Outlook, Yahoo Mail, even Roundcube and Horde. I can't say that I'm familiar with snoozing email, so I had to look it up: it's basically a way to remind yhe iser to respond to a message later.

Given that, I would say that no, snoozing an email and archiving it are different things, regardless of the snooze duration. With my workflow, I archive any email that no longer requires my feedback, so anything that is still in my inbox would probably be the same as one that has been snoozed anyways.

If you're snoozing messages forever, you may want to reconsider your approach to managing your inbox. Snoozing a message over and over seems like a lot of wasted action. Why not just leave it in the inbox if it's short-term or set up a calendar reminder if it's long-term instead?
